My Previous MH, a 2000 Georgie Boy 36ft DP. bought new.. at about 9-10 years old I prepped and applied ZEP Acrylic. After the 1st year there was peeling of the acrylic just on the fiberglass area above the windshield. Because that area was hard to get to and not prepped properly. (Probably the 1 year problem he had in the video) I stripped just that area and reapplied the ZEP. Then washed the RV and reapplied ZEP to the entire RV.
After that, each year I washed and re-coated the ZEP, 2-3 coats. No peeling or yellowing until I sold the coach in 2015. Just wipe on a thin wet coat and by the time you complete one coat it's dry enough for the next. (wear latex gloves)
I used the ZEP on just the fiberglass sidewalls, and end caps, not on the roof or the painted cargo doors.
I agree it's not for full body paint but more for an older rig that has lost it's shine.
